Hypothesis: trust failures are asymmetric

HypothesisEV-011

A proposition the author believes is worth testing. No evidence is claimed for it yet.

Scope
The meeting assistant category.
Observation
The author's proposition is that one fabricated commitment costs more trust than ten correct extractions earn, which would make the critical-defect count the metric a buyer should ask about first.
Limitations
Untested. It is consistent with how the acceptance criteria in this benchmark are written, but that is a design choice, not evidence.
